The role of Audio Visual Control Systems Programmer (AV Programmer) serves a multifaceted role, primarily responsible for programming and testing various control systems, including Crestron, Extron, AMX, QSC, and Biamp, as well as programming audio DSP systems. The AV Programmer will ensure systems function correctly and will adjust and troubleshoot as necessary. Additionally, the AV Programmer will work closely with project teams and clients to ensure seamless integration and operation of AV systems.

Roles and Responsibilities

  • Participate in project kickoffs to coordinate and develop a successful programming plan.
  • Support and mentor technicians assigned to projects, enhancing their installation and troubleshooting skills.
  • Conduct advanced troubleshooting and commissioning of AV systems.
  • Program and configure control systems including Crestron, Extron, AMX, QSC, and Biamp.
  • Program audio DSP systems from manufacturers such as Biamp, QSC, and BSS, including setup, testing, tuning, and adjustment.
  • Upload and test control code on-site, making adjustments as needed.
  • Communicate effectively with field technicians or manufacturers for real-time troubleshooting.
  • Maintain communication with customers, co-workers, and manufacturers for project updates, troubleshooting, commissioning, and training.
  • Assist with site evaluations, testing, and troubleshooting alongside Account Managers, Engineers, and Programmers.
